Overview and career summary

Kendall Jenner is a model, media personality, and businessperson known for a career built on long-running modeling work and high-profile brand partnerships. This profile focuses on verifiable roles, major projects, and commercial activities rather than short-lived moments, aiming to provide durable context for ongoing interest. Jenner became widely known as a public figure through reality television and fashion appearances, then expanded into beauty and lifestyle ventures that reach a global audience.

AttributeVerified DetailSource Type
Full nameKendall Nicole JennerPublic records / biographical references
Date of birthNovember 3, 1995Public biographies and legal documents
Primary rolesModel, media personality, founderOfficial brand materials and press
Notable venturesKylie Cosmetics (early involvement), Kendall + Kylie, 818 TequilaBusiness registrations and launch announcements
Industry focusFashion, beauty, lifestyleBrand partnerships and public appearances

Modeling career background

Jenner began modeling at a young age, appearing in runway and print work while still in her teens. Early placements introduced her to major fashion hubs and established a pattern of long-term contracts rather than one-off appearances. Over time, she moved from junior campaigns to front-row presence at prominent fashion weeks and covers of leading international magazines. These achievements reflect sustained industry engagement, which is central to her ongoing public profile. Key highlights include working with household-name brands and being featured in editorial spreads that reach a global audience.
